High- or Low-Side, Bidirectional, High Accuracy Current Sense Amplifier

- Voltage-output, Current-shunt Monitor
- Wide Common Mode Operation Range: -0.3V~26V
- Gain=50V/V
- Amplifier’s Output Referenced to VREF input
- Shunt Drop Range:
- - -40mV to 40mV (VCC=5V,REF=2.5V)
- - 1mV to 90mV (VCC=5V,REF=0V)
- Low Offset Voltage: ±100μV (Maximum)
- 0.5μV/°C Offset Drift (Maximum)
- Accuracy: ±0.5% Gain Error (Maximum)
- 10ppm/°C Gain Drift (Maximum)
- Quiescent Current: 100μA (Maximum)
- Packages: SOT363
The SY24641 fixed-gain, high-precision, high-side or low-side, current-sense amplifier with voltage output is suitable for bidirectional (charge /discharge) or unidirectional current measurements. The SY24641 provides 50V/V output gain.
The SY24641 uses a low-offset, zero-drift architecture and operates across the -0.3V to 26V input common-mode voltage range, which is independent of supply voltage. The precision input offset voltage (VOS) allows the device to measure the low-voltage drop very accurately.
The SY24641 is designed to operate from a 3V to 5.5V supply and draws just 80µA (typ) quiescent current.
The device is provided in an SOT363 package and are specified over the extended industrial temperature range of -40°C to 125°C.
